Перейти к содержимому
Кука Тех
К
Кука Тех
Москва
16 активна · проверена 23 часа назад

Strong Middle Fullstack Developer

Ищем strong middle fullstack-разработчика для SaaS-платформы по автоматизации рекрутмента. Нужно разрабатывать фичи от API до UI на Python (FastAPI) и React/TypeScript, работать с MongoDB, Redis, Docker и внешними интеграциями. Предлагают удалённую работу, влияние на архитектуру и продуктовую разработку без тяжёлого legacy.

middle удалённо ~729 300 – 1 458 600 ₸
Вакансия опубликована 30 дней назад. Может быть уже неактуальна — рекомендуем уточнить статус у работодателя перед откликом.
Языки: English · Pre-Intermediate
salary intelligence

Зарплата не указана — оценили по рынку

На основе 29 похожих вакансий за 90 дней.

оценка p25–p75
729 300 – 1 458 600 ₸
медиана: 1 326 000 ₸
Хотите увидеть распределение по грейдам и городам? Зарплаты Python Калькулятор зарплат
Вакансии в Telegram-канале
Свежие вакансии Каждый день
Подписаться
??%
Match Score
Войдите и создайте резюме
Войти
описание

Что предстоит делать

О продукте Разрабатываем SaaS-платформу для автоматизации рекрутмента с мультитенантной архитектурой, большим количеством внешних интеграций (джоб-борды, мессенджеры, ATS-системы) и AI-функциональностью на базе LLM. Развиваем продукт более 2 лет: это уже не пустой greenfield, но без тяжёлого legacy и с возможностью влиять на архитектурные решения. Кого ищем Strong middle fullstack-разработчика, который умеет самостоятельно брать задачу, уточнять спорные места, предлагать рабочее решение и доводить его до продакшена с ревью команды. Это роль для человека, которому комфортно работать на обеих сторонах стека: от API, фоновых задач и интеграций до UI, компонентов и дизайн-системы. Фокус между backend и frontend примерно поровну, с возможным перекосом в зависимости от спринта.

  • Разрабатывать фичи от API до UI — проектирование эндпоинтов, бизнес-логика на бэкенде, интерфейс на фронте
  • Разрабатывать и поддерживать backend-сервисы на FastAPI: REST API, webhook-обработчики, фоновые воркеры
  • Развивать и поддерживать ATS-приложение: новые фичи, рефакторинг, оптимизация
  • Разрабатывать внутреннее приложение (back office)
  • Участвовать в развитии внутренней библиотеки компонентов (ui-kit) и дизайн-системы
  • Интегрироваться с внешними сервисами: джоб-борды, мессенджеры, ATS-системы, платёжные сервисы
  • Работать с асинхронной логикой, очередями, ретраями и обработкой ошибок во внешних интеграциях
  • Интегрировать фронтенд с REST API бэкенда (типы генерируются из OpenAPI-схемы)
  • Писать unit- и интеграционные тесты
  • Участвовать в code review и принятии технических решений
  • Разбираться в существующей кодовой базе и аккуратно развивать её
  • Поддерживать и улучшать инженерную среду: CI/CD (GitHub Actions + Docker), линтинг (Biome), Storybook
  • Что для нас важно — Backend
  • Python 3.11+ — уверенное владение языком, типизацией, Pydantic
  • Асинхронное программирование — понимание event loop, async/await, конкурентности, корректная работа с таймаутами и отменами
  • FastAPI / REST API — построение и поддержка API, dependency injection, middleware, версионирование, пагинация, обработка ошибок, аутентификация (JWT)
  • MongoDB — уверенный практический опыт, понимание индексов, агрегаций и особенностей документоориентированной модели
  • Redis — кэширование, очереди задач, базовые паттерны синхронизации
  • Внешние интеграции — опыт работы с внешними API, webhook-ами, обработка ошибок интеграций
  • Тестирование — pytest, unit- и интеграционные тесты
  • Что для нас важно — Frontend
  • React — hooks, Context API, lazy/Suspense, оптимизация рендеров, state management, роутинг, data fetching
  • TypeScript — дженерики, discriminated unions, type guards, strict mode
  • REST API — интеграция с бэкендом, работа с OpenAPI-схемами, OAuth-флоу (refresh-токены)
  • CSS Modules + PostCSS — кастомные миксины, nesting, CSS-переменные как дизайн-токены, адаптивная вёрстка (без CSS-фреймворков)
  • Vite — конфигурация, code splitting, оптимизация бандла
  • Компонентные библиотеки — опыт работы с ui-kit или дизайн-системой
  • Тестирование — Vitest, React Testing Library
  • Что для нас важно — общее
  • Docker — уверенная работа с контейнерами и Docker Compose
  • Git / PR / code review — нормальная инженерная практика командной разработки
  • AI-инструменты для разработки — готовность использовать AI-инструменты в ежедневной разработке
  • Какой стиль работы нам подходит
  • Внимательность к деталям — важна аккуратность, особенно в задачах, связанных с биллингом, интеграциями и мультитенантностью
  • Системное мышление — понимание, как изменение на одной стороне стека влияет на другую: API-контракты, типы, воркеры, вебхуки
  • Продакшен-мышление — умение разбираться в логах, ошибках интеграций и причинах инцидентов
  • Самостоятельность — умение разбираться в задаче, принимать решения и доводить до результата
  • Инициативность — не просто закрывать тикеты, а предлагать улучшения в архитектуре, DX, производительности
  • Письменная коммуникация — основная коммуникация асинхронная: чёткие описания PR, внятные комментарии к задачам
  • Ответственность за результат — доводить задачу до рабочего состояния: проверить, покрыть тестами, пройти проверки перед ревью
  • Реалистичная оценка сроков — готовность заранее поднимать риски
условия

Что предлагаем

Удалённая работа, полный рабочий день
Оформление по ТК РФ
Часовой пояс команды — МСК (UTC+3)
Продуктовая разработка — реальные задачи с ощутимым влиянием на продук
Влияние на архитектурные решения
навыки

Стек и инструменты

Подходит ли вам эта вакансия?

Зарегистрируйтесь и загрузите резюме — посчитаем % совпадения с этой вакансией, подсветим сильные стороны и что стоит подтянуть

Создать аккаунт PDF-парсинг резюме за 2 минуты

Похожие вакансии

6 вакансий
К
Крупный российский банк
1 д. назад

Python разработчик (общеплатформенные решения)

~729 300 – 1 458 600 ₸ оценка

Ищем Python-разработчика для создания общеплатформенных сервисов и инструментов для разработчиков. Нужно знание FastAPI, SQLAlchemy, Docker, Kubernetes и опыт с асинхронным кодом. Предлагают удаленную работу, гибкий график, ДМС и возможности для обучения.

Python FastAPI SQLAlchemy +13
middle удал. hh
МАГНИТ, Розничная сеть
М
МАГНИТ, Розничная сеть
1 д. назад

Fullstack-разработчик

~729 300 – 1 458 600 ₸ оценка

Ищем fullstack-разработчика для автоматизации контроля качества товаров. Нужно проектировать и разрабатывать API на Python, создавать frontend на Vue, работать с Postgres и Kubernetes. Требуется опыт от 2 лет, умение составлять ТЗ и покрывать код тестами.

Postgres Python Vue +5
middle удал. hh
Альфа-Банк
А
Альфа-Банк
1 д. назад

Python разработчик (Data Office)

~729 300 – 1 458 600 ₸ оценка

Ищем Python-разработчика для внедрения и поддержки цифровых сервисов в дата-офисе. Нужен опыт от 3 лет, уверенное владение Python, FastAPI/Flask, SQL и Git. Предлагаем удаленную работу, ДМС и возможности для роста.

Python FastAPI Flask +7
middle удал. hh
ИЦ АЙ-ТЕКО
И
ИЦ АЙ-ТЕКО
2 д. назад

Python разработчик

~729 300 – 1 458 600 ₸ оценка

Ищем опытного Python-разработчика для создания сервисов на базе больших языковых моделей и AI-агентов. Требуется глубокий опыт в Python, машинном обучении и работе с LLM. Компания предлагает стабильную работу, белую зарплату, ДМС и профессиональное развитие.

Python LLM AI +20
middle удал. hh
Quintagroup
Q
Quintagroup
2 д. назад

Python разработчик

~2 162 201 – 3 322 750 ₸ оценка

Ищем опытного Python разработчика для работы над финтех-продуктом в европейской компании. Требуется 4+ года опыта с Python и AWS, знание Django и сопутствующих технологий. Предлагают удаленную работу, гибкий график, медстраховку и долгосрочные проекты.

Python Django AWS +6
middle удал. dj
C
Компания
2 д. назад

ML Engineer

~2 162 201 – 3 322 750 ₸ оценка

Ищем ML-инженера с опытом от 3 лет для работы над ранжированием объявлений и оптимизацией моделей. Нужны глубокие знания Python и опыт в DevOps/MLOps. Приветствуется знание рекомендательных систем.

ML Python DevOps +2
middle удал. HR cr